Ordering my New Civic

Having looked at the car, with a test drive under the belt and deposit paid. I am now changing my Golf MK5 for a Civic.

Nothing particularly wrong with the Golf, just that circumstances and timing are good at the moment. Have got a good trade in offer on the Golf, which will mean no hassle of a private sale.



I have decided on the Black, I know the keeping clean issues, but it does look very good and suits the coupe style lines. It will be an EX (cos' I like my gadgets), and the dealer will include mats and the paint protection treatment (which should help keeping the black clean).

I am also contemplating the leather, which comes with panoramic roof. I like the heated seat option in the winter, and also leather is very practical to keep clean. Must decide by tomorrow on the leather/roof, but I am thinking I may well go for it.
